Output 6123400f70ae24d4bfa150773255d7590c93317af3e93223a71cd11286959a16:10

value
2650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fae45ebb1673abf32ad89828a8a7df48feb7c1a OP_EQUAL
address
3EnjKgfZJxrnx5MkKh6pUQPAbhNrxmgLEx
transaction
6123400f70ae24d4bfa150773255d7590c93317af3e93223a71cd11286959a16
spent
true